Term Life Versus Whole Life Insurance: Frequently Asked Questions

In this article we may once again look at whole life insurance vs term life insurance. We may try to gain some clarity concerning this subject.

Let us first try to define whole and term life insurance.

Whole life insurance may also be called permanent life assurance. It is an insurance that endows the insured person with death protection for her whole lifetime. An insurance payout is rewarded to the beneficiaries stated in the contract when the insured person dies. Whole life policies usually include an investment section that builds up a cash value.

Term life cover has a time limit on the period of coverage. The time limit may be extended by renewing the term policy once it expires. The insured person’s beneficiaries will receive no insurance payout if the policy expires before the insured person’s death.

Now we may discuss the 2 key types of whole life insurance to be had.

Participating

A participating whole life policy disburses dividends. The dividends normally result from surplus investment earnings and expenditure savings. Dividends may be rewarded in cash, although it is not always guaranteed to be paid out to you.

Non-Participating

A non-participating whole life policy does not pay you any dividends. The premiums remain level during your entire lifetime. The policy’s face value is fixed.

There are also 2 key types of term life insurance. Let us quickly examine them.

Increasing term

An increasing term policy’s face value increases over the duration of the policy. The premiums remain fixed.

Decreasing term

A decreasing term policy’s face value decreases throughout the existence of the policy until it reaches nothing at the policy’s conclusion date. The premiums remain unchanged. A decreasing term plan is frequently utilized to cover an expense such as a home mortgage.

Let us now consider the advantages of whole life assurance.

* The life coverage lasts for your whole lifetime.
* The annual premiums are fixed.
* A part of the premiums are invested.

Here are some advantages of term life assurance.

* Term cover may be easier to comprehend.
* Term cover is reasonably priced.
* Term insurance can be used to provide cover for temporary needs.

Next, we should review the disadvantages of whole life assurance.

* Fixed premiums are much more expensive than term premiums.
* There are better investment options available than the investment options offered by whole life policies. You can most likely do better by investing and saving on your own.

Then we may look at some disadvantages of term life assurance.

* Term cover offers only death protection.
* Term insurance can provide cover for temporary needs but is less suitable for long term needs.

Finally, let us conclude this chat about whole life insurance vs term life insurance.

Whole life cover may be less costly in the long run than term life cover in spite of the more expensive initial insurance premiums. Whole life policies may also build up a cash value or earn non-guaranteed dividends. In the end, the long term costs of whole life policy may be less than the overall cost of a term life policy.

Term assurance presents temporary protection with a low initial cost.

In conclusion, both types of life insurance have their own advantages and disadvantages.
